By Diego Adrian Naya Lazo
OSWorkflow is an open-source workflow engine written totally in Java with a versatile method and a technical user-base objective. it's published below the Apache License. you could create uncomplicated or complicated workflows, looking on your wishes. you could concentration your paintings at the company common sense and principles. not more Petri internet or finite kingdom computing device coding! you could combine OSWorkflow into your software with at the least fuss. OSWorkflow presents the entire workflow constructs that you simply may come upon in real-life tactics, reminiscent of steps, stipulations, loops, splits, joins, roles, and so on. This e-book explains intimately the entire a number of elements of OSWorkflow, with out assuming any past wisdom of commercial approach administration. Real-life examples are used to elucidate innovations.
Read or Download OSWorkflow: A guide for Java developers and architects to integrating open-source Business Process Management PDF
Similar java books
Begin construction strong courses with Java 6—fast!
Get an summary of Java 6 and start development your individual programs
Even if you're new to Java programming—or to programming in general—you can wake up and operating in this wildly renowned language in a rush. This e-book makes it effortless! From how one can set up and run Java to realizing periods and gadgets and juggling values with arrays and collections, you'll get in control at the new good points of Java 6 in no time.
Discover how to
* Use object-oriented programming
* paintings with the adjustments in Java 6 and JDK 6
* store time by way of reusing code
* Troubleshoot code difficulties and connect insects
The newest version of Java in a Nutshell is designed to aid skilled Java programmers get the main out of Java 7 and eight, yet it’s additionally a studying course for brand new builders. Chock jam-packed with examples that display easy methods to take entire good thing about sleek Java APIs and improvement top practices, the 1st component of this completely up to date publication offers a fast paced, no-fluff creation to the Java programming language and the center runtime points of the Java platform.
If youre conversant in JIRA for factor monitoring, trojan horse monitoring, and different makes use of, you recognize it could actually occasionally be tough to establish and deal with. during this concise booklet, software program toolsmith Matt Doar solutions tricky and frequently-asked questions about JIRA management, and exhibits you the way JIRA is meant for use.
Over 60 hands-on recipes that will help you successfully create advanced and hugely custom-made company intranet recommendations with Liferay Portal 6. x CE approximately This BookLearn how one can use Liferay Portal to create an absolutely practical intranet company with a transparent constitution and database of all departments and staff of your companySave a while and funds through taking regulate of your facts, records, and company processesPacked with step by step, real-world examples that will help you with the set up, deployment, and configuration of Liferay and that can assist you run strong instruments in your staff or clientsWho This e-book Is ForIf you're a Java developer or administrator with a technical heritage and need to put in and configure Liferay Portal as an firm intranet, this can be the booklet for you.
- Programming Spiders, Bots and Aggregators in Java
- Wireless Java developing with J2ME
- Beginning Java EE 6 with GlassFish 3, 2nd Edition
- J2EE Developer's Handbook
- Core JSTL: Mastering the JSP Standard Tag Library
Additional info for OSWorkflow: A guide for Java developers and architects to integrating open-source Business Process Management
Info OSWorkflow Introduction and Basics Optionally, if the manager approves or denies the request, we can send an email to the employee. info Chapter 2
The following figure depicts the OSWorkflow concept model. registers trigger-functions global-conditions initial-actions workflow global-actions common-actions steps splits joins In the next section, we will explore the different constructs OSWorkflow has to assemble in a definition. An Example Workflow We will use a business process that a medium to large company would encounter at least once a year—the holiday workflow. Every time you need days to rest or travel, you request your supervisor to sanction the holidays.
How Components Map to the BPM Lifecycle In the first section of the chapter, we saw the BPM lifecycle—the usual methodology to implement BPM in a single process or whole enterprise. The BPMS components align with this methodology by giving a tool for each part of the cycle. The next figure shows the mapping between components and the BPM lifecycle. Workflow Engine Model Workflow Engine Deploy Modeler Test Monitor BAM The modeling phase has the process modeler, the test and deployment (execution) phases uses the workflow engine, and finally the monitoring (optimization) phase is supported by the BAM.